#672f8b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#672f8b is composed of 40.4% red, 18.4%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.9%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 276.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.5% and a lightness of 36.5%. #672f8b color hex could be obtained by blending #ce5eff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#672f8b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050207 is the darkest color, while #faf7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#672f8b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5a60 is the less saturated color, while #7004b6 is the most saturated one.
